Read moreIt's quite common to assume that conditioner is essential for soft and healthy hair, but some people find that their hair actually feels better and looks healthier after they stop using it. This counterintuitive effect can happen for several reasons. First, many conditioners contain heavy silicones and other buildup-forming ingredients that coat hair strands, potentially weighing hair down and making it feel greasy or lifeless over time. If these products are not properly washed out, the buildup can prevent natural oils from nourishing the hair. Second, some hair types, especially fine or oily hair, may respond better to lighter or no conditioners at all. When conditioner is overused or not suited for your specific hair needs, it can lead to clogged hair follicles or scalp irritation, ultimately harming hair health. Third, the hair’s natural oil production may rebalance when conditioner is eliminated. Without the artificial smoothing agents, your scalp may produce just the right amount of natural oils that keep hair protected and moisturized without excess buildup. For those considering skipping conditioner, experimenting with washing frequency, switching to gentle sulfate-free shampoos, or using light leave-in conditioners might help achieve the best results. Also, incorporating deep conditioning treatments once in a while or using conditioners with natural ingredients and no heavy silicones can maintain softness without compromising hair health. Ultimately, everyone's hair is unique, so what works for one person might be different for another. If ditching conditioner has made your hair softer and healthier, it could be because your hair benefits from minimal product buildup and a more natural oil balance. Listening to your hair and adjusting your routine accordingly is key to healthy hair care.
